What you’ll be doing
- Build and manage the temporary turnaround site layout for contractor trailers, laydown yards, fabrication areas, lunchrooms, and staging locations.
- Coordinate mobilization and demobilization of cranes, aerial lifts, generators, and other critical equipment.
- Serve as the point of contact for logistics vendors supporting security, parking, transportation, fuel, and workforce movement.
- Keep temporary facilities operating by solving day-to-day site issues before they impact the schedule.
- Coordinate waste removal, hydro-blasting support, vacuum trucks, portable sanitation, and other critical turnaround services.
- Partner closely with the Turnaround Scheduler to ensure logistics stay aligned with the execution schedule.
